… without having had their oxygen supply cut off or being sub- merged in this buoyant magnesium phosphate, potash, bromine-filled lake — the lowest point any- where on earth. Now, a physiologist at Ben…

…-Gurion University's Center for Health Sciences has discovered just what causes the unconscious state and eventual death of Dead Sea drowning victims. By conducting experi- ments on rats and carefully examining the

… medical re- cords of previous cases and those recently brought to Beersheba's Soroka Hospi- tal — the teaching hospital affiliated with BGU's medi- cal school — Dr. Reuven Yagil has shown that any- one

… how it is possible to drown from a gulp of Dead Sea water. With these funds he carried out extensive re- search on rats. "Inserting Dead Sea water directly into the stomachs of rats — even they can't be…

… Rabbi Daniel Nevins and Rabbi Herbert Yoskowitz will lead three Sunday morning discussions at Adat Shalom Synagogue on "Three Trials That Rocked the Jewish World." The programs are set for 10 a.m. Sunday…

…, Oct. 13, 20, 27. On Oct. 13, Rabbi Yoskowitz will talk about the two famous trials of Captain Alfred Dreyfus resulting from the explosive Dreyfus affair in France and their effect on French Jewry today…

…. On the following Sunday, Rabbi Nevins will discuss the Schwartzbard trial of 1927 in which the young "Jewish vigilante of Paris" was acquit- ted for the murder of a Ukranian nationalist who led pogroms…

… that took the lives of many Jewish villagers. The series will conclude on Oct. 27 with a presentation by Rabbi Yoskowitz on the Beilis blood libel tri- als. These trials, which began in 1913, involved a…

… Jew who was accused in Kiev of the murder of a Christian boy for ritual purposes. The Adat Shalom Sisterhood and Men's Club are planning brunches at 9:30 on those mornings by advance registration only…
